
Robins & Morton has begun work on the $150 million vertical expansion at Huntsville Hospital Madison Street Tower in Huntsville, Alabama. The five-story, 154,000-square-foot project will add 120 beds, as well as a cardiothoracic intensive care unit, a neuro intensive care unit for neurosurgical and stroke patients, three floors of new acute medical space, and a new and improved emergency department vehicle entrance.
Additionally, 70 existing patient rooms will be converted from double occupancy to single occupancy. When the expansion is complete, the hospital will have a total of 931 patient beds, up from 881 currently.
The project is scheduled for completion in 2027. Robins & Morton, which built the Madison Street Tower in 2006, is serving as the general contractor. Chapman Sisson Architects is the architect.
